This engaging musical instrument research project allows Year 3-6 students to discover, research, and present an instrument of their choice. Perfect for students studying instruments of the orchestra, contemporary music or music from around the world!
Students will create a hanging display to showcase their findings in a fun and interactive way.
Great for music lessons, independent projects, or classroom displays, this activity encourages curiosity, creativity, and a deeper understanding of musical instruments!
What This Research Project Includes:
12 templates, both with AUS/UK and US spelling options:
⚪️ Title Page
⚪️ My Instrument
⚪️ Me and My Instrument (Self Portrait)
⚪️ This Project is By
⚪️ Where My Instrument Comes From
⚪️ What It Is Made Of
⚪️ Parts of My Instrument
⚪️ How to Play It
⚪️ Three Fun Facts
⚪️ Why I Chose this Instrument
⚪️ How it Sounds
⚪️ My Instrument’s Family
